Elizabeth Clare McLaren-Throckmorton (ne d'Abreu; 18 August 1935 31 October 2017), known professionally as Clare Tritton, QC, was a British barrister and descendant of the Throckmorton baronets. Dahl worked with toymaker Stanley Wade and paediatric neurosurgeon Kenneth Till to invent the Dahl-Wade-Till (DWT) valve to ensure the tube never again became blocked.
